Have you ever heard about a blue hole? A blue hole is a submarine cave or sinkhole. - Great Blue Hole, Belize
You can find this hole in Lighthouse Reef Atoll (60 miles from Belize City) with depth around 123 m (400 ft) and width around 305 m (1000 ft).
- The Blue Hole, Dahab
This blue hole also known as the “World’s Most Dangerous Dive Site”. The depth of this hole is about 130 m with a tunnel at 52 m.
- Dean’s Blue Hole, Bahamas
This hole is one of the deepest blue hole in the world with its 663 ft deep. The name Dean was taken from the family who own the island nearby.
- The Blue Hole, Gozo
This blue hole is not clearly as visible from the surface. It started at 7 m deep and there’s a cave at 15 m deep that full of tuna, groupers and barracuda.
- The Blue Cave, Korcula
The blue hole is entered at 9 m below the surface inside the cave and has depth about 35 m.
